Compare Colorado Northwestern Community College and IBMC College

Both Colorado Northwestern Community College and IBMC College are 2-4 years schools located in Colorado. The following statements compare Colorado Northwestern Community College and IBMC College with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• IBMC's tuition ($15,320) is more expensive than CNCC ($7,084).
  • IBMC's students to faculty ratio (8 to 1) is lower than CNCC (15 to 1).
  • CNCC (1,179 students) is larger than IBMC (384 students) with more enrolled students.
  • IBMC ($9,452) has higher amount of financial aid than CNCC ($6,443).
  • IBMC's graduation rate (67%) is higher than CNCC (31%).
